INFORMATION

FontID: 04994EMB
Church/Chapel: Eglise paroissiale [ancienne cathédrale] Notre-Dame du Réal [sometime known as Notre-Dame-des-Rois]
Church Patron Saints: St. Stephen
Church Location: place Auguste Thouard, 05200 Embrun, France
Country Name: France
Location: Hautes-Alpes,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ur
Directions to Site: Embrun is 37 km E of Gap, at the extreme NE side of the Lac de Serre-Ponçon, 86 km SW of Briançon, down the N94 (near the Italian border)
Ecclesiastic Region: Diocèse de Gap
Font Location in Church: Inside the church, attached to one of the colums of the west end of the nave
Century and Period: 12th - 13th century, Romanesque
Cognate Fonts: many others such animals used as bases of columns in the south of France and Italy
On-site notes: a lovely couchant lion (?) of the type [stylofore] often found in Italian and south-eastern French churches serving as bases of columns, pulpits, etc. In this case it appears that the object may have been recycled by adding a stone basin on top and making it into a holy-water stoup. The porch of this church has two similar couchant lions (one holds a cub?, the other a child, as is common in these parts) serving as bases for the columns there.
